國(guó)產(chǎn)Linux發(fā)行版 Deepin 評(píng)價(jià)與主觀展望 我與Deepin的故事
全文皆屬于up自己的主觀臆斷,有不到之處可以進(jìn)行批評(píng),共同成長(zhǎng)。
? 昨天,我刷b站的時(shí)候見到一則舊聞,關(guān)于我國(guó)操作系統(tǒng)的。原本只是想寫個(gè)1000字左右的評(píng)論的,沒想到寫了這么多。
從了解Deepin開始到現(xiàn)在差不多也有了5年時(shí)間,其實(shí)Deepin不是我最早了解的國(guó)產(chǎn)Linux發(fā)行版,我最早了解的一個(gè)叫優(yōu)麒麟的操作系統(tǒng)。我大概是從4年級(jí)開始接觸到了虛擬機(jī),接下來(lái)差不多5年級(jí)我就開始接觸Linux了,還是要感謝國(guó)產(chǎn)Linux發(fā)行版,否則我都不知道Linux系統(tǒng)。一開始我接觸Linux只能在虛擬機(jī)上,那時(shí)候Linux適配做的不是很好,尤其是那時(shí)候我用的一張山寨顯卡,導(dǎo)致在非windows下顯卡驅(qū)動(dòng)加載不了。
? ? ? 還記得我5年級(jí)的時(shí)候,為了在Ubuntu上面打一把minecraft,下午一放學(xué)回到家就開始琢磨在電腦上安裝java。那時(shí)候我還很菜,網(wǎng)絡(luò)社區(qū)也不如現(xiàn)在怎么發(fā)達(dá),我也不知道linux有apt啊yum這些東西,搞得我一連好幾天都在搞,從編譯java,配置環(huán)境變量,發(fā)現(xiàn)顯卡驅(qū)動(dòng)不對(duì)勁,換顯卡驅(qū)動(dòng)(同理,那時(shí)候我也不知道驅(qū)動(dòng)管理器,安裝網(wǎng)上的教程一步一步來(lái),關(guān)掉窗口服務(wù),進(jìn)純命令行模式,執(zhí)行nvidia的那個(gè)顯卡驅(qū)動(dòng)安裝)。就這樣過(guò)了好幾天我終于才在linux吃上了minecraft。
? 好了,廢話少說(shuō)。我第一次使用的Deepin是2016年的時(shí)候,具體版本號(hào)已經(jīng)忘記了。我印象中深度不是做盜版windows系統(tǒng)的嗎(up的第一個(gè)xp安裝鏡像就是深度的),怎么做起自己的操作系統(tǒng)了。不過(guò)那時(shí)候Deepin給我留下的印象很好,UI簡(jiǎn)潔大方,應(yīng)用商店簡(jiǎn)單易用。就是那時(shí)候我電腦顯卡支持不如Ubuntu好,在Ubuntu上面選對(duì)版本號(hào)我的山寨顯卡起碼還能驅(qū)動(dòng),在deepin上面我就只能用開源驅(qū)動(dòng)了。就這樣我差不多用了一個(gè)月,實(shí)在忍不了動(dòng)不動(dòng)就卡個(gè)花屏后,無(wú)奈換回了Windows系統(tǒng)。這就是我與Deepin
?的第一次邂逅。
? 在后來(lái),我的那張山寨顯卡終于在一次渲染視頻的時(shí)候燒毀了,于是我換上了我現(xiàn)在所用的電腦。而我也總于有條件用上我熱愛的Deepin。那時(shí)候電腦的各個(gè)硬件基本都能正常驅(qū)動(dòng),網(wǎng)頁(yè)也流暢,沒有出現(xiàn)花屏的現(xiàn)象了。我在那臺(tái)Deepin上體驗(yàn)了人生第一個(gè)開源游戲,第一次使用apt,第一次使用Deepin提供的crossover安裝QQ,第一次用lvm給自己磁盤上了個(gè)鎖。每次都不亦樂乎,還時(shí)不時(shí)向朋友吹噓自己使用的是國(guó)產(chǎn)操作系統(tǒng)。我那時(shí)候剛上初中,有一次閱讀文章中出現(xiàn)了deep的派生詞,全班就我一個(gè)人翻譯對(duì)了,我那時(shí)候真的很感謝深度,讓我這個(gè)英語(yǔ)白癡有機(jī)會(huì)在班上嶄露頭角。???
? 但是這種快樂的生活隨著一次版本更新終結(jié)了,那個(gè)版本是深度首發(fā)顯卡驅(qū)動(dòng)管理器的版本。更新前我熱淚盈眶,更新后800x600的分辨率把我惡心的老淚縱橫(nvidia wdnmd)。我嘗試把之前手動(dòng)安裝的nv驅(qū)動(dòng)清理掉后再用深度官方的顯卡驅(qū)動(dòng)管理器安裝新驅(qū)動(dòng),結(jié)果還是濤聲依舊,于是我告別了我所用的Deepin。
? 過(guò)了不知道多久,大概是在18年。我不知道是被Windows下的垃圾廣告流氓程序惡心到了,還是收到了linux大法的真切呼喚(主要是中美貿(mào)易戰(zhàn)),我又回來(lái)了。我為了完完全全的體驗(yàn)deepin,以及了解到普通用戶對(duì)deepin的感受,我還給我媽的電腦上安裝了deepin。不管怎么說(shuō)安裝是真的比以前順利了很多。我媽那時(shí)候喜歡看電視連續(xù)劇,所以我打算用wine給他裝個(gè)優(yōu)酷或者是pps愛奇藝(那時(shí)候PPS和愛奇藝好像才剛剛合并)。但是無(wú)論怎么樣都安裝不了,忌憚?dòng)陔u毛撣子的威力,我又給我媽的電腦安裝回了Windows,而我的電腦仍是Deepin。后來(lái)由于那時(shí)候我一直在學(xué)習(xí)1一種小眾的編程語(yǔ)言(易語(yǔ)言),且該編程語(yǔ)言ide只支持Windows,我又放棄了Deepin。
? 我有一次心血來(lái)潮玩起了caffe深度學(xué)習(xí)這些東西,鑒于在windows上面配置太麻煩,我換成了Linux,我一開始是打算在Deepin上面搭建環(huán)境的。但是還是那個(gè)該死的顯卡驅(qū)動(dòng),我電腦是開了raid 0的,為了快速啟動(dòng)(開機(jī)時(shí)候不會(huì)顯示那個(gè)遠(yuǎn)古的raid配置界面)我把安全啟動(dòng)打開了(uefi的那個(gè))。但是Deepin死活是沒有支持安全啟動(dòng),導(dǎo)致我安裝不上顯卡驅(qū)動(dòng),raid的盤顯示加載也不正常。主要還是不支持cuda加速。我換成了Ubuntu,據(jù)我所知,Ubuntu在18.04的時(shí)候就對(duì)我的電腦的安全啟動(dòng)支持比較好(在最新的版本中已經(jīng)可以像Windows那樣把logo換成主板的制造商logo,而不是Ubuntu logo了),我曾經(jīng)也向Deepin官方反饋過(guò),但是始終沒有答復(fù)。
?? ?上一次看見Deepin的官方b站賬號(hào)說(shuō)迅雷將要發(fā)布在Linux上,我二話沒說(shuō)回來(lái)了,Deepin已是v20了。我顯卡也換成Vega56并且刷好了wx8200的BIOS,但是amd的Pro的最新顯卡驅(qū)動(dòng)只支持Ubuntu18.04。我沒能打上官方驅(qū)動(dòng)。但我還是這樣堅(jiān)持用了下來(lái),不管怎么說(shuō)Deepin的生態(tài)是越來(lái)越好了。wps用起來(lái)也不錯(cuò),剪輯視頻用Blender(還是沒有顯卡加速),對(duì)于我來(lái)說(shuō)基本也夠。steam上面對(duì)linux有支持的游戲挺多的,再不濟(jì)也能開個(gè)wine玩,整體感覺還是不錯(cuò)的。但是依然存在嚴(yán)重的兼容性BUG,運(yùn)行時(shí)間長(zhǎng)了之后,屏幕會(huì)異常白屏(就是整個(gè)屏幕變白,系統(tǒng)沒有反應(yīng))??赡苁窍到y(tǒng)休眠上面的BUG不吧。
? 總結(jié)一下,Deepin近幾年的發(fā)展勢(shì)頭是越來(lái)越好了,有國(guó)內(nèi)大廠的支持(雖然力度不夠,但是遠(yuǎn)比以前要好),有更多的技術(shù)成熟的人才。但是我覺得Deepin還是太年輕了,就拿最近的說(shuō),最近的UI那個(gè)圓角太圓了,我用qt的窗口甚至出現(xiàn)了一些輕微的bug(比如圓角的附近窗口底色覆蓋不到)。不知道是Deepin的開發(fā)人員認(rèn)為這么圓是很好看還是怎么樣,目前就我所知的一些操作系統(tǒng)都沒有這么圓的圓角。而且這ui莫名的像MacOS(Deepin UI走點(diǎn)心吧)。
?還有就是作為一個(gè)小的個(gè)人開發(fā)者對(duì)Deepin的評(píng)價(jià),鑒于Deepin本身就是個(gè)Linux,開發(fā)環(huán)境沒什么好說(shuō)的,Linux有什么Deepin就有什么。但是作為一個(gè)長(zhǎng)期使用Windows API的開發(fā)者來(lái)說(shuō),在Deepin上面開發(fā)是真的難受(雖然比MacOS上面 malloc.h 不叫 malloc.h ,還少幾個(gè)函數(shù)好)?,但是要實(shí)現(xiàn)一些實(shí)用功能,我認(rèn)為我不太習(xí)慣。比如抓取窗口截圖,在Windows上面我思路十分清晰,可是在不熟悉的Deepin上面一籌莫展。我覺得Windows之所以受到大量開發(fā)者的青睞,不僅僅是因?yàn)樵械能浖鷳B(tài),關(guān)鍵是他的完好的開發(fā)者社區(qū)以及官方提供的開發(fā)工具和知識(shí)庫(kù)(比如vs msdn)。深度既然能為普通用戶做妥協(xié),為什么不能為開發(fā)者妥協(xié)呢。Windows系統(tǒng)龐大的生態(tài)鏈里更多的難道不是個(gè)人開發(fā)者開發(fā)的小工具嗎。期待有一天,我打開我的Deepin 能看到一個(gè) deepin studio,include的時(shí)候能看見一個(gè) deepin.h。我知道,這樣將與Linux的開源精神背道而馳,但是不這樣相對(duì)其它Linux也沒競(jìng)爭(zhēng)優(yōu)勢(shì)。
? 所以我更覺得Deepin不應(yīng)該局限于Linux,為什么不看看bsd,雖然我沒有用過(guò)諸如freebsd這類系統(tǒng),但是據(jù)我所知,他們也是可以兼容Linux應(yīng)用的。為什么Deepin不借助bsd呢。我希望Deepin在借助Linux帶來(lái)的生態(tài)環(huán)境,也可以擺脫原有Linux的生態(tài)鏈,走自己的路。
? 我用Deepin差不多也有5年了,這5年我看到了Deepin的成長(zhǎng),Deepin也見證了我的成長(zhǎng)。鑒于現(xiàn)在的時(shí)代大背景下,Deepin一定會(huì)迎來(lái)春天。
希望Deepin能越做越好。
由于本up主的閱歷還很淺薄,本文章使用手機(jī)碼字。有不到之處,請(qǐng)各位讀者多多包涵。